2.1.1. Organización del procesador

download 2.1.1. Organización del procesador

of 3

Transcript of 2.1.1. Organización del procesador

  • 7/22/2019 2.1.1. Organizacin del procesador

    1/3

    Organizacin del Prcesadr

    Para comprender la organizacin del procesador, consideremos los requisitos que ha decumplir:

    Captar instruccin: el procesador lee una instruccin de la memoria (registro, cach omemoria principal).

    Interpretar instruccin: la instruccin se decodifica para determinar qu accin esnecesaria.

    Captar datos: la ejecucin de una instruccin puede exigir leer datos de la memoria o deun mdulo de E/S.

    Procesar datos: la ejecucin de una instruccin puede exigir llevar a cabo alguna operacinaritmtica o lgica con los datos.

    Escribir datos: los resultados de una ejecucin pueden exigir escribir datos en la memoriao en un mdulo de E/S.

    Para hacer estas cosas, es obvio que el procesador necesita almacenar algunos datos

    temporalmente.

  • 7/22/2019 2.1.1. Organizacin del procesador

    2/3

    Debe recordar la posicin de la ltima instruccin de forma que pueda saber de dnde

    tomar la siguiente. Necesita almacenar instrucciones y datos temporalmente mientras una

    instruccin est ejecutndose. En otras palabras, el procesador necesita una pequea memoria

    interna.

    La Figura 12.1 es una visin simplificada de un procesador. que indica su conexin con el

    resto del sistema a travs del bus del sistema. Sera necesaria una interfaz similar para

    cualquiera de las estructuras de interconexin descritas en el Captulo 3. El lector recordar que

    los principales componentes del procesador son una unidad aritmtico lgica (arithmetic and logic

    unit, ALU) y una unidad de control (control unit, CUlo La ALU lleva a cabo el verdadero clculo o

    procesamiento de datos. La unidad de control controla las transferencias de datos e instrucciones

    hacia dentro y hacia fuera del procesador, y el funcionamiento de la ALU. Adems, la figuramuestra una memoria interna mnima, que consta de un conjunto de posiciones de

    almacenamiento llamadas registros.

    La Figura 12.2 presenta una visin un poco ms detallada del procesador. Se indican los

    caminos de transferencia de datos y de la lgica de control, que incluyen un elemento con el

    rtulo bus interno del procesador. Este elemento es necesario para transferir datos entre los

    diversos registros y la ALU, ya que la ALU en realidad solo opera con datos de la memoria interna

    del procesador. La figura muestra tambin los elementos bsicos tpicos de la ALU. Observe la

    similitud entre la estructura interna del computador en su totalidad y la estructura interna del

    procesador. En ambos casos hay una pequea coleccin de elementos principales (computador:

    procesador, E/S, memoria; procesador: unidad de control, ALU, registros) conectados por caminos

    de datos.

  • 7/22/2019 2.1.1. Organizacin del procesador

    3/3